什么是数据库的安全

worktile 其他 23

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库的安全是指保护数据库系统和其中存储的数据免受未经授权的访问、损坏或篡改的一系列措施和方法。数据库的安全性非常重要,特别是对于包含敏感信息的数据库,如个人身份信息、财务数据等。

    以下是数据库安全的几个重要方面:

    1. 访问控制:访问控制是数据库安全的基本要求之一。通过用户认证和授权机制,只有经过授权的用户才能访问数据库。数据库管理员应该设置强密码策略,并限制用户的访问权限,以确保只有合法用户能够访问数据库。

    2. 数据加密:数据加密是数据库安全的重要手段之一。通过对敏感数据进行加密,即使数据库被攻击或泄露,黑客也无法读取加密的数据。常见的加密技术包括对称加密和非对称加密,可以选择适合自己需求的加密算法和密钥管理方法。

    3. 审计和监控:数据库的审计和监控是实现数据库安全的重要手段之一。通过记录和监控数据库的操作日志,可以及时发现异常行为和安全事件,并采取相应的措施进行处理。此外,还可以使用安全审计工具对数据库进行实时监控和分析,提升数据库的安全性。

    4. 异地备份和灾难恢复:数据库的异地备份和灾难恢复是数据库安全的关键措施之一。通过定期将数据库备份到异地存储设备或云存储中,可以保证在发生灾难或数据丢失情况下能够快速恢复数据库。备份数据应加密存储,并定期测试恢复过程以确保备份数据的完整性和可用性。

    5. 漏洞修复和安全更新:数据库供应商会不断发布安全更新和补丁来修复已知的漏洞和安全问题。数据库管理员应及时关注供应商的安全公告,及时安装和应用这些更新和补丁,以保证数据库的安全性。

    综上所述,数据库的安全性是保护数据库和其中存储数据免受未经授权访问、损坏或篡改的重要措施和方法。通过访问控制、数据加密、审计和监控、异地备份和灾难恢复以及漏洞修复和安全更新等手段,可以提升数据库的安全性,保护敏感信息的安全。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的安全是指保护数据库免受未经授权的访问、修改、泄露、破坏或其他恶意活动的影响。数据库安全包括物理安全、逻辑安全和数据隐私保护等方面。

    首先,物理安全是指保护数据库服务器和存储介质的安全。这包括控制物理访问,例如限制机房的进入权限,安装监控摄像头等。此外,还需要定期备份数据库,并将备份数据存储在安全的地方,以防止数据丢失。

    其次,逻辑安全是指保护数据库系统免受未经授权的访问和攻击。这包括设置强密码策略,限制用户访问权限以及定期更新和升级数据库软件和补丁。此外,还可以使用防火墙和入侵检测系统等安全工具来监控和阻止潜在的攻击。

    另外,数据隐私保护是指保护数据库中存储的敏感数据不被未经授权的人员获取。这可以通过加密技术来实现,例如使用SSL/TLS协议对数据传输进行加密,使用加密算法对数据库中的敏感数据进行加密存储。此外,还可以采用数据脱敏和数据掩码等技术来保护数据的隐私。

    综上所述,数据库的安全是一个综合性的问题,需要从物理安全、逻辑安全和数据隐私保护等多个方面进行考虑和保护。只有在保护好数据库的安全的前提下,才能确保数据的完整性、可用性和机密性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的安全是指确保数据库的数据和结构不受未经授权的访问、修改、破坏或泄露的保护措施。数据库的安全性是一个综合性的概念,包括物理安全、逻辑安全和操作安全等多个方面。

    1. 物理安全:

      • 数据库服务器的物理环境应该受到保护,包括安全的机房、门禁系统、视频监控等。
      • 数据库服务器的访问控制应该进行限制,只有授权的人员才能进入。
      • 数据库服务器的备份应该进行加密,并存放在安全的地方。
    2. 逻辑安全:

      • 数据库的访问控制:通过用户和权限管理来限制对数据库的访问,只有经过授权的用户才能访问数据库。
      • 数据库的加密:对敏感的数据进行加密,确保即使被盗取也无法解密。
      • 数据库的审计和监控:对数据库的操作进行审计和监控,及时发现异常操作和安全威胁。
    3. 操作安全:

      • 数据库管理员的权限控制:数据库管理员应该只有必要的权限,且应该定期审计其操作。
      • 数据库的备份和恢复:定期进行数据库的备份,并确保备份的安全和完整性。
      • 数据库的补丁和更新:及时安装数据库的补丁和更新,修复已知的安全漏洞。
      • 数据库的审计和日志:记录数据库的操作日志,以便追溯和分析异常操作。

    此外,数据库的安全还需要考虑网络安全、应用程序安全和数据传输安全等方面的保护措施。需要综合考虑数据库的整体安全策略,并定期进行安全评估和漏洞扫描,以及及时响应和处理安全事件。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部